Abstract
This paper proposes a procedure optimizing capacity of energy resources for zero-energy housing complex. The procedure consists of three steps: All power consumption data from every house are synchronized to calculate total energy consumption; renewable energy capacity is then decided to achieve zero-energy by compensating the energy consumption with energy generation; and energy storage capacity is finally decided to optimize a feature obtained by simulating its operation based on a numerical model. The optimization procedure was verified by simulations using a program written in Python language.
